Responsible for all aspects of the Activity and Volunteer programs designed to meet the resident's social, physical, mental, emotional, and sensory needs. Job Responsibilities and Duties
- Maintain strong positive relationships with residents, families, caregivers, potential residents, community contacts, current residents, and staff. Represent the organization in a manner that is consistent with its mission and values.
- Responsible for planning, promotion, budgeting and facilitating/leading activity events or programs.
- Develop the organizations monthly calendar of activities for IL, AL & MC residents. Ensure this calendar represent an active, well-rounded menu of programs for all aspects of the community.
- Ensure that activities are supervised by staff or volunteers
- Lead activities as necessary to ensure their success and consistency
- Evaluate programming to meet current and future needs.
- Work with vendors, such as entertainers, to enrich the activities calendar with an array of musical, educational, spiritual, and entertaining features each month.
- Supervise campus activities personnel by giving direction, mentoring, administering corrective action, and evaluating performance on a regular basis.
- In coordination with the Director of Nursing, support the training and mentoring of Resident Assistants assigned to Memory Care in the portion of their responsibilities that includes leading activities.
- Responsible for promotion of volunteer opportunities, including volunteer recruitment, training, supervision, and recognition programs. Maintain files on volunteers which include appropriate background checks, resumes, reference check information, and evaluations.
- Work with Resident Council and other committees to plan, implement, advertise, and evaluate resident selected activities and programs.
- Coordinate transportation needs to outside events/programs in accordance with established policies and procedures.
- Accompany residents on field trips as needed.
- Other duties as assigned.
